ObjectChecker

Source file "org/eclipse/jgit/lib/ObjectChecker.java" was not found during generation of report.

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total2,169 of 2,1690%375 of 3750%2412414784784848
checkNotWindowsDevice(byte[], int, int, AnyObjectId)2840%700%3838464611
checkTree(AnyObjectId, byte[])2300%420%2222606011
checkPersonIdent(byte[], AnyObjectId)2040%240%1313373711
checkPathSegment2(byte[], int, int, AnyObjectId)1870%300%1717363611
isNTFSGitmodules(byte[], int, int)1570%260%1414272711
isMacHFSPath(byte[], int, int, byte[], AnyObjectId)1100%280%1616333311
duplicateName(byte[], int, int)780%140%88272711
checkCommit(AnyObjectId, byte[])750%120%77191911
checkTag(AnyObjectId, byte[])740%100%66181811
scanPathSegment(byte[], int, int, AnyObjectId)630%120%77161611
check(AnyObjectId, int, byte[])510%70%66181811
isNormalizedGit(byte[], int, int)490%140%88111111
isGitTilde1(byte[], int, int)470%120%775511
isGitmodules(byte[], int, int, AnyObjectId)420%140%886611
checkId(byte[])410%20%22111111
static {...}310%n/a11101011
report(ObjectChecker.ErrorType, AnyObjectId, String)300%100%666611
matchLowerCase(byte[], int, byte[])300%60%446611
toHexString(byte[], int, int)290%20%224411
checkPath(byte[], int, int)270%40%337711
checkPathSegment(byte[], int, int)270%40%336611
isMacHFSGit(byte[], int, int, AnyObjectId)270%n/a112211
isGit(byte[], int)260%60%443311
checkTruncatedIgnorableUTF8(byte[], int, int, AnyObjectId)250%20%226611
ObjectChecker()220%n/a115511
idFor(int, byte[])180%20%224411
match(byte[], byte[])170%20%225511
normalize(byte[], int, int)160%20%222211
setIgnore(ObjectChecker.ErrorType, boolean)150%20%225511
isInvalidOnWindows(byte)140%60%443311
toLower(byte)140%40%333311
setIgnore(Set)130%20%224411
checkPath(String)100%n/a113311
isPositiveDigit(byte)100%40%331111
check(int, byte[])90%n/a112211
checkCommit(byte[])80%n/a112211
checkTag(byte[])80%n/a112211
checkTree(byte[])80%n/a112211
isMacHFSGitmodules(byte[], int, int, AnyObjectId)80%n/a111111
setSkipList(ObjectIdSet)50%n/a112211
setAllowLeadingZeroFileMode(boolean)50%n/a111111
setAllowInvalidPersonIdent(boolean)50%n/a112211
setSafeForWindows(boolean)50%n/a112211
setSafeForMacOS(boolean)50%n/a112211
reset()40%n/a112211
getGitsubmodules()30%n/a111111
newBlobObjectChecker()0%n/a111111
checkBlob(byte[])0%n/a111111